Determine the mass of zirconium_______________, silicon__________________, and oxygen________________, found in 0.3384 mol of zircon, ZrSiO4, a semiprecious stone. Your answer must have the correct number of significant figures.Enter the number only, with no units.
1) Determine the mass of zirconium
Convert moles of zircon into moles of zirconium
\(\text{molesofZr}=0.3384molesofZrSiO_4\cdot\frac{1\text{molofZr}}{1molofZrSiO_4}=0.3384\text{molesofZr}\)Convert moles of zirconium into mass of zirconium (g)
\(\text{gramsofZr}=0.3384\text{molesZr}\cdot\frac{91.224\text{ g Zr}}{1\text{molofZr}}=30.87\text{ g Zr}\)2) Determine the mass of Silicon
Convert moles of zircon into moles of silicon
\(\text{molesofSi}=0.3384molesofZrSiO_4\cdot\frac{1\text{molofSi}}{1molofZrSiO_4}=0.3384\text{molesofSi}\)Convert moles of silicon into mass of silicon (g)
\(\text{gramsofSi}=0.3384\text{molesofSi}\cdot\frac{28.085\text{ g of Si}}{1\text{molofSi}}=9.504\text{ g Si}\)3) Determine the mass of Oxygen
Convert moles of zircon into moles of oxygen
\(\text{molesofO}=0.3384molesofZrSiO_4\cdot\frac{4\text{molofO}}{1molofZrSiO_4}=1.3536\text{molesofO}\)Convert moles of oxygen into mass of oxygen
\(\text{gramsofO}=1.3536\text{molesofO}\cdot\frac{15.999\text{ g O}}{1\text{mol of O}}=21.66gO\)The mass of zirconium is 30.87 g
The mass of silicon is 9.504 g
The mass of oxygen is 21.66 g

(a) (i) A vehicle travels an average of 7.5 km per litre of fuel used. How many kg of CO2 are output per week, if it travels 300 km/week. One litre of fuel weighs 0.75 kg. The fuel combustion process is described by: 2 C8H18 + 25 02 16 CO2 + 18 H₂O (+ energy) → The atomic masses of Carbon, Hydrogen and Oxygen are: C = 12, H = 1, 0 = 16 (b) (ii) Explain in one sentence how the Biofuel Obligation Scheme is implemented in Ireland to reduce the country's carbon footprint.
(i) The vehicle outputs approximately 11.58 kg of CO₂ per week. (ii) The Biofuel Obligation Scheme in Ireland is implemented by requiring fuel suppliers.
To calculate the amount of CO₂ output per week, we need to determine the amount of fuel used and then use the given combustion equation to find the ratio of CO₂ produced per unit of fuel.
Given;
Average fuel efficiency: 7.5 km per litre
Distance traveled per week: 300 km
Mass of fuel per litre: 0.75 kg
First, we calculate the total fuel used per week;
Fuel used = Distance traveled / Fuel efficiency
= 300 km / 7.5 km per litre
= 40 litres
Next, we find the mass of fuel used per week:
Mass of fuel used = Fuel used × Mass of fuel per litre
= 40 litres × 0.75 kg per litre
= 30 kg
Using the combustion equation, we know that 2 moles of C₈H₁₈ produce 16 moles of CO₂. Therefore, we can calculate the moles of CO₂ produced from the given mass of fuel;
Moles of CO₂ produced = Moles of C8H18 × (16 moles of CO₂ / 2 moles of C₈H₁₈)
= (30 kg / (114 g/mole)) × (16 moles of CO₂ / 2 moles of C₈H₁₈)
= (30,000 g / 114 g/mole) × (16 moles of CO₂ / 2 moles of C₈H₁₈)
= 263.16 moles of CO₂
Finally, we convert the moles of CO₂ to kilograms;
Mass of CO₂ produced = Moles of CO₂ produced × Molar mass of CO₂
= 263.16 moles × (44 g/mole)
= 11,579.04 g
= 11.58 kg (rounded to two decimal places)
Therefore, the vehicle outputs approximately 11.58 kg of CO₂ per week.
The Biofuel Obligation Scheme in Ireland is implemented by requiring fuel suppliers to include a certain percentage of biofuels in their overall fuel sales, thereby reducing the carbon footprint by promoting the use of renewable and lower-carbon-emitting fuels.

Magnesium unites completely and vigorously with oxygen to form magnesium oxide, which contains 60% magnesium by weight. If 1.00 gram of magnesium is sealed in a glass tube with 1.00 gram of oxygen, what will be present in the tube after the reaction has taken place
Answer:
After the reaction, there will 0.60 g of magnesium oxide and 0.25 g of oxygen gas present in the tube
Explanation:
Equation of the reaction between magnesium and oxygen is given as follows:
2Mg(s) + O₂(g) ---> 2MgO(s)
From the equation of reaction, 2 moles of magnesium reacts with i mole of oxygen gas to produce 1 mole of magnesium oxide
molar mass of magnesium is 24.0 g; molar mass of oxygen gas = 32.0 g; molar mass of magnesium oxide = 40.0 g
Therefore 24 g of magnesium reacts with 32 g of oxygen gas
I.00 g of magnesium will react with (24.0 / 32.0) * 1.00 g of oxygen = 0.75 g of oxygen gas.
Therefore, magnesium is the limiting reagent. Once it is used up, the reaction will stop and the excess oxygen will be left in the tube together with the product, magnesium oxide.
mass of excess oxygen = 1.00 - 0.75 = 0.25 g
mass of magnesium oxide formed = (24.0 / 40.0 g) * 1 = 0.60 g
